Toyota Prius Tire Pressure (PSI)

Recommended tire pressure varies by year, tire size, and load. Check door jamb sticker for your specific vehicle.

Year RangeTrim/ConfigFront PSIRear PSISpare
2023-2025LE / XLE (17" wheels)363560
2023-2025Limited (19" wheels)363560
2016-2022L Eco (15" wheels)333260
2016-2022LE / XLE (15" wheels)353360
2016-2022Limited (17" wheels)363560
2017-2022Prime PHEV (15" wheels)353560
2010-2015All Trims (15" wheels)353360
2010-2015All Trims (17" wheels)363560
Note: Always verify using the tire information placard on the driver's door jamb. Prius models are sensitive to tire pressure for optimal fuel economy. Pressure may vary based on tire size and load conditions.

Toyota Prius Lug Nut Torque Specs

Year RangeWheel TypeTorque (ft-lb)Torque (Nm)Socket Size
2023-2025All Wheels7610321mm
2016-2022All Wheels7610321mm
2010-2015All Wheels7610321mm
Torque Pattern: Use a star pattern when tightening lug nuts. Tighten in 3 stages (50%, 75%, 100%). Re-torque after 50-100 miles.

Toyota Prius Oil Capacity

YearEngineCapacity (qt)Capacity (L)Oil Type
2023-20252.0L Hybrid I44.44.20W-16
2019-20221.8L Hybrid I44.44.20W-16
2017-20221.8L PHEV I4 (Prime)4.44.20W-16
2016-20181.8L Hybrid I44.44.20W-20
2010-20151.8L Hybrid I44.44.20W-20
Filter Note: Capacity includes filter. Use Toyota OEM or equivalent high-quality filter. Always verify with dipstick after filling. Some models may have capacity variations.

Additional Prius Specs

Spark Plug Torque

EngineTorque (ft-lb)Gap
2.0L Hybrid I4 (2023+)180.039-0.043"
1.8L Hybrid I4 (2010-2022)180.039-0.043"

Drain Plug Torque

ComponentTorque (ft-lb)
Oil Pan Drain Plug27
Transaxle Drain Plug36
Inverter Coolant Drain27

Transaxle Fluid Capacity

Year RangeCapacity (qt)Type
2023-20257.4 (total)Toyota ATF WS
2016-20227.0 (total)Toyota ATF WS
2010-20156.9 (total)Toyota ATF WS

Hybrid Battery Info

ModelBattery TypeVoltageWarranty
Prius (2023-2025)Lithium-Ion201.6V10yr/150k mi
Prius (2016-2022)Nickel-Metal Hydride201.6V10yr/150k mi
Prius Prime PHEV (2017-2022)Lithium-Ion207V10yr/150k mi
Prius (2010-2015)Nickel-Metal Hydride201.6V8yr/100k mi
